The ACES test I gave to my college students the other day was the expanded 14 question one which does include growing up in foster/orphanage care, but doesn't add anything about abandonment, which I know a lot of these kids really struggle with. Many of them only had 1 ACE, which was growing up in an orphanage, but we know that that does cause many of the same developmental delays due to lack of attachment.
